Decide whether the following statements are true or false. Explain your answer. a. If X has a normal distribution with μ=8,\mu = 8, then P(X8.21)=P(X7.79).P(X \geq 8.21)=P(X \leq 7.79). b. If X has a normal distribution, then the probability is about 0.87 that its value will be within 1.5 standard deviations of the mean.

PART A:

Note that all normal distributions are symmetrical about their mean values. Furthermore, the points X=8.21X=8.21 and X=7.79X=7.79 are both equidistant from the mean μ=8\mu=8. Finally, the inequality signs also point in opposite directions. Therefore, we can conclude that P(X8.21)=P(X7.79)P\left(X\geq8.21\right)=P\left(X\leq7.79\right) is a true statement.
